Форум русскоязычного сообщества Ubuntu


Хотите сделать посильный вклад в развитие Ubuntu и русскоязычного сообщества?
Помогите нам с документацией!

Автор Тема: Автовход в систему Ubuntu Server 10.10  (Прочитано 9396 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н pipe

  • Администратор
  • Старожил
  • *
  • Сообщений: 5843
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#15 : 30 Ноября 2010, 16:35:34 »
Цитировать
Ну вот смотрите: включаю комп с ubuntu server, со второго компа (под виндой) пытаюсь через PuTTY подконектится к "серверу" - просто черное окно....

Там по идее у тебя логин должны спросить, а после пароль. Что-то не то с самим сервером, такое принципиально не должно быть.

Оффлайн Slimline

  • Автор темы
  • Новичок
  • *
  • Сообщений: 33
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#16 : 30 Ноября 2010, 17:55:17 »
Цитировать
Ну вот смотрите: включаю комп с ubuntu server, со второго компа (под виндой) пытаюсь через PuTTY подконектится к "серверу" - просто черное окно....

Там по идее у тебя логин должны спросить, а после пароль. Что-то не то с самим сервером, такое принципиально не должно быть.

Если подкинуть моник - спрашует, ввожу. Поcле, когда конекчусь патти он уже спрашует лог+пас и пускает меня

Оффлайн Nomadian

  • Участник
  • *
  • Сообщений: 232
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#17 : 30 Ноября 2010, 18:04:27 »
Что-то не то с настройками сервера... Просто чёрное окно без сообщений об отказе в доступе означает, что в сети сервер нашёлся, но при ssh-соединении не откликается... Я бы начал с проверки сетевых настроек - шлюза и маски подсети - на сервере, поскольку он запрос "ест", а ответ,очевидно, шлёт неизвестно куда.

Кстати, это свежеустановленный сервер или давно "замучанная" машинка? Это случайно не шлюз с перенастроенными iptables?
« Последнее редактирование: 30 Ноября 2010, 18:06:28 от Nomadian »

Оффлайн Slimline

  • Автор темы
  • Новичок
  • *
  • Сообщений: 33
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#18 : 30 Ноября 2010, 18:25:35 »
Ну как сказать свежая...собрана недавно с того, что было под рукой и с того что выпросил/выкупил у друзей/знакомых.

Вы говорите какие файлы показать - я покажу.

iptables я трогал, но и до того как я его "трогал" ssh не работал, я первым делом его ставил (на голую систему, инет уже работал).

Оффлайн Nomadian

  • Участник
  • *
  • Сообщений: 232
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#19 : 30 Ноября 2010, 22:36:38 »
Варианты многочисленны...

1) "От печки": как раздаются ip-адреса в сети на обе машины: DHCP, фиксированные? Если фиксированные, какие адреса на сервере и клиенте, какие маски подсети, какие шлюзы? На сервере интересует файл /etc/network/interfaces

2) Что выводит tracert под Windows, когда не откликается сервер? (tracert == traceroute под *nix)

3) Вообще, пингуется ли сервер в такой момент?

4) Что на сервере с /etc/ssh/sshd_config?

P.S.: Кстати, я бы ни за что на сервер не ставил 10.10, зачем? Для серверов существуют LTS дистрибутивы, тем более, что 10.04 LTS весьма свежа.

Оффлайн proctoleha

  • Активист
  • *
  • Сообщений: 364
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#20 : 30 Ноября 2010, 23:49:26 »
У меня server 10.04, правда на виртуалке, но суть от этого не меняется, вот скрин после запуска, я не вошел:



вот скрин путти, все прекрасно коннектится:



Косяк: частенько путти коннектится со второго раза, т.е. запустил сервак, запустил путти - черное окно, закрыл путти, запустил второй раз, все ОК.

Адреса статические
« Последнее редактирование: 30 Ноября 2010, 23:51:24 от proctoleha »
За что я временами ненавижу Linux - так это за свои кривые руки

Оффлайн Nomadian

  • Участник
  • *
  • Сообщений: 232
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#21 : 01 Декабря 2010, 01:36:28 »
У меня на работе 7 серверов разного назначения под Ubuntu 10.04 server и десятка два клиентских Ubuntu-мест. Доступ по ssh беспроблемен без какой бы то ни было локальной загрузки. Разницы в уверенности доступа между Windows PuTTy, терминалом под Ubuntu, консолью другого сервера или Терминал.app под Mac OS нет (вот такая разношёрстная техника в офисе :)).

У ТС, скорее всего, причина неурядиц в конфигурации сети или ssh.

Оффлайн pipe

  • Администратор
  • Старожил
  • *
  • Сообщений: 5843
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#22 : 01 Декабря 2010, 04:24:43 »
Я еще о такой проблеме читал, что ubuntu server не грузилась  без клавы, без монитора. 2 разных случая описанно в проблеммах было, попробуй цепануть сначало клаву и зацепиться по ssh, потом монитор. Причем не надо вбивать данные, а просто воткни и перезагрузи. Может у тебя один из тех редких случаев. Плюс еще в Bios может стоять настройка, что комп не грузиться без клавы.

Оффлайн Slimline

  • Автор темы
  • Новичок
  • *
  • Сообщений: 33
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#23 : 01 Декабря 2010, 10:57:01 »
Цитировать
1) "От печки": как раздаются ip-адреса в сети на обе машины: DHCP, фиксированные? Если фиксированные, какие адреса на сервере и клиенте, какие маски подсети, какие шлюзы? На сервере интересует файл /etc/network/interfaces
Айпи фиксированые и на сервере и на второй машине.
На сервере 2 сетевых. Одна смотрит в инет (апи, шлюз, днс - все дает провайдер), вторая в локальную сеть (айпи тоже фиксированый).

Цитировать
2) Что выводит tracert под Windows, когда не откликается сервер? (tracert == traceroute под *nix)
Не понял что имеется ввиду. Что значит "не откликаеться"?

Цитировать
3) Вообще, пингуется ли сервер в такой момент?
То есть, когда серв включен но не выполнен вход? Не проверял. Проверю.

Цитировать
4) Что на сервере с /etc/ssh/sshd_config?
после установки менялся только порт (который стандартный port 22), остальное не трогал.

Цитировать
P.S.: Кстати, я бы ни за что на сервер не ставил 10.10, зачем? Для серверов существуют LTS дистрибутивы, тем более, что 10.04 LTS весьма свежа.
И я об етом задумался....Наверно поставлю (в скором времени) 10.04 LTS.




Пользователь решил продолжить мысль 01 Декабря 2010, 11:05:32:
Цитировать
Я еще о такой проблеме читал, что ubuntu server не грузилась  без клавы, без монитора. 2 разных случая описанно в проблеммах было, попробуй цепануть сначало клаву и зацепиться по ssh, потом монитор. Причем не надо вбивать данные, а просто воткни и перезагрузи. Может у тебя один из тех редких случаев. Плюс еще в Bios может стоять настройка, что комп не грузиться без клавы.
Он у меня стоит все время с подключеной клавой. Монитор подкидую когда нужно сделать вход, потом отключаю. Я все таки тоже склонен думать, что ето скорее всего что то не то с настройкой.

Чуток позже скопипастю сюда interfaces и ssh_config.
« Последнее редактирование: 01 Декабря 2010, 11:05:32 от Slimline »

Оффлайн RustemNur

  • Почётный модератор
  • Старожил
  • *
  • Сообщений: 2939
  • умрешь с вами
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#24 : 01 Декабря 2010, 11:12:11 »
Я еще о такой проблеме читал, что ubuntu server не грузилась  без клавы, без монитора.

Подтверждаю насчет клавы. Дома сервачок у меня не грузится без нее.
На работе все гуд (3 сервера).
Насчет монитора было обсуждение (лень искать), но там у людей сервер загибался через 20 минут только (если я все правильно помню).

Оффлайн Slimline

  • Автор темы
  • Новичок
  • *
  • Сообщений: 33
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#25 : 01 Декабря 2010, 13:54:59 »
interfaces

auto eth0
iface eth0 inet static
pre-up iptables-restore < /etc/iptables.up.rules
         address 109.86.13.5
        netmask 255.255.255.0
        network 109.86.13.0
        broadcast 109.86.13.255
        gateway 109.86.13.254
        dns-nameservers 109.86.2.2 109.86.2.21

auto eth1
iface eth1 inet static
        address 192.168.0.1
        netmask 255.255.255.0
        network 192.168.0.0
        broadcast 192.168.0.255

ssh_config


# This is the ssh client system-wide configuration file.  See
# ssh_config(5) for more information.  This file provides defaults for
# users, and the values can be changed in per-user configuration files
# or on the command line.

# Configuration data is parsed as follows:
#  1. command line options
#  2. user-specific file
#  3. system-wide file
# Any configuration value is only changed the first time it is set.
# Thus, host-specific definitions should be at the beginning of the
# configuration file, and defaults at the end.

# Site-wide defaults for some commonly used options.  For a comprehensive
# list of available options, their meanings and defaults, please see the
# ssh_config(5) man page.

Host *
#   ForwardAgent no
#   ForwardX11 no
#   ForwardX11Trusted yes
#   RhostsRSAAuthentication no
#   RSAAuthentication yes
#   PasswordAuthentication yes
#   HostbasedAuthentication no
#   GSSAPIAuthentication no
#   GSSAPIDelegateCredentials no
#   GSSAPIKeyExchange no
#   GSSAPITrustDNS no
#   BatchMode no
#   CheckHostIP yes
#   AddressFamily any
#   ConnectTimeout 0
#   StrictHostKeyChecking ask
#   IdentityFile ~/.ssh/identity
#   IdentityFile ~/.ssh/id_rsa
#   IdentityFile ~/.ssh/id_dsa
#   Port 22
#   Protocol 2,1
#   Cipher 3des
#   Ciphers aes128-ctr,aes192-ctr,aes256-ctr,arcfour256,arcfour128,aes128-cbc,3$
#   MACs hmac-md5,hmac-sha1,umac-64@openssh.com,hmac-ripemd160
#   EscapeChar ~
#   Tunnel no
#   TunnelDevice any:any
#   PermitLocalCommand no
#   VisualHostKey no
#   ProxyCommand ssh -q -W %h:%p gateway.example.com
    SendEnv LANG LC_*
    HashKnownHosts yes
    GSSAPIAuthentication yes
    GSSAPIDelegateCredentials no



Оффлайн Nomadian

  • Участник
  • *
  • Сообщений: 232
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#26 : 02 Декабря 2010, 01:21:22 »
С /etc/network/interfaces всё нормально.

1) ssh_config - это конфигурация ssh-клиента, а нужен sshd_config - конфигурация ssh-сервера.

Чтобы понять в какой момент соединение обрывается:
- Можно посмотреть, где "обламывается" PuTTy по её логу.
- Можно после запуска сервера, но до логина на нём, т.е. когда ssh-соединение не устанавливается, набрать на Windows машине:
telnet 192.168.0.1 <ssh-порт>(если порт стандартный, то telnet 192.168.0.1 22.)
Нормальный ответ будет вроде:
telnet 192.168.0.1 22
Trying 192.168.0.1...
Connected to 192.168.0.1.
Escape character is '^]'.
...

Независимо от того предполагаю, что надо проверять два варианта:
2) Нет ли ошибки в конфигурировании iptables (т.е. в /etc/iptables.up.rules)?
    Хотя исчезновение проблемы после входа противоречит этой идее.
3) Не закрыт ли ssh порт средствами ufw или другого файрвола?
« Последнее редактирование: 02 Декабря 2010, 01:23:41 от Nomadian »

Оффлайн Slimline

  • Автор темы
  • Новичок
  • *
  • Сообщений: 33
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#27 : 02 Декабря 2010, 11:08:34 »
Будете смеяться, но я решил проблему заменой батарейки на мат. плате))

Расказую: комп собрал не давно, дня как четыре наверно, так как стоит он пока в моей комнате, я его на ночь выключаю (мешает спать). Утром рано ухожу на работу и уже с работы звоню домой и прошу включить его. Соль в чем: они включают, я пробую по ssh подключиться - не какой реакции. Прошу ввести лог+ пасс, они вводят - все норм. Но не кто ж мне не говорил, что когда они его включают настройки биоса не установлены (так как батарейка дохлая и не сохраняются настройки) и на екране висит надпись типа: нажмите Ф1 чтоб продолжить, ДЕЛ для установки параметров....Загрузка дальше етого екрана не идет и я не могу подключиться....писец...теперь все норм) спасибо за помощь или хотя бы за попытку помочь)

Оффлайн prodigy

  • Новичок
  • *
  • Сообщений: 40
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#28 : 02 Декабря 2010, 11:25:19 »
 :2funny: :2funny: :2funny:

Оффлайн pipe

  • Администратор
  • Старожил
  • *
  • Сообщений: 5843
    • Просмотр профиля
Re: Автовход в систему Ubuntu Server 10.10
« Ответ #29 : 02 Декабря 2010, 11:30:00 »
Я почти угадал  :D

 

Страница сгенерирована за 0.042 секунд. Запросов: 23.